Browse Source

ajout imapsync

develop-etcd
fabrice.regnier 4 months ago
parent
commit
49ccb6551b
  1. 1
      config/container-withoutMail.list.tmpl
  2. 7
      config/dockers.tmpl.env
  3. 17
      dockers/proxy/config/nginx.tmpl.conf

1
config/container-withoutMail.list.tmpl

@ -3,3 +3,4 @@ ethercalc
collabora
etherpad
web
imapsync

7
config/dockers.tmpl.env

@ -87,11 +87,13 @@ wordpressHost=wp
mobilizonHost=mobilizon
vaultwardenHost=koffre
traefikHost=dashboard
imapsyncHost=imapsync
########################################
# ports internes
matterPort=8000
imapsyncPort=8080
########################################
# noms des containers
@ -120,8 +122,6 @@ vaultwardenServName=vaultwardenServ
traefikServName=traefikServ
prometheusServName=prometheusServ
grafanaServName=grafanaServ
ethercalcDBName=ethercalcDB
etherpadDBName=etherpadDB
framadateDBName=framadateDB
@ -134,9 +134,8 @@ vigiloDBName=vigiloDB
wordpressDBName=wpDB
mobilizonDBName=mobilizonDB
vaultwardenDBName=vaultwardenDB
ldapUIName=ldapUI
imapsyncServName=imapsyncServ
########################################
# services activés par container.sh

17
dockers/proxy/config/nginx.tmpl.conf

@ -305,6 +305,23 @@ server {
}
}}
#############################################
# imapsync
{{imapsync
server {
server_name __IMAPSYNC_HOST__.__DOMAIN__;
include includes/port;
ssl_certificate /etc/letsencrypt/live/__DOMAIN__/fullchain.pem;
ssl_certificate_key /etc/letsencrypt/live/__DOMAIN__/privkey.pem;
include includes/proxy_params;
location / {
include includes/allow_ip;
proxy_pass http://__IMAPSYNC_HOST__.__DOMAIN__:8080;
}
}
}}
########################################
#### mattermost
{{mattermost

Loading…
Cancel
Save